The cost y (in dollars) to provide food for guests at a dinner party is proportional to the number x of guests attending the party. It costs $30 to provide food for 4 guests.



a. Write an equation that represents the situation.

b. Interpret the slope.

y = k x

30 = k * 4
k = 30/4 = 15/2 = 7.5
so
y = 7.5 x
the slope is $ 7.50 per eater
